Ordinals
beta
Sat 759405415366274
decimal
151881.415366274
degree
0°151881′681″415366274‴
percentile
36.162162676267634%
name
ilwppqbpxnb
cycle
0
epoch
0
period
75
block
151881
offset
415366274
timestamp
2011-11-04 22:51:08 UTC
rarity
common
prev
next